A277
COMPLEMENTARY OUTPUT HALL EFFECT
LATCHED SINK DRIVER
FEATURES
! On-chip Hall sensor with two different sensitivity and hysteresis settings for A277.
! Internal bandgap regulator allows temperature compensated operations and a wide
operating voltage range.
! High output sinking capability up to 400mA for driving large load.
! Lower current change rate reduces the peak output voltages during switching.
! Build in protection diode for chip reverse power connecting.
! Available in die form or rugged low profile 4 pin SIP packages.
GENERAL DESCRIPTION
A277 are integrated Hall sensors with output drivers designed for electronic commutation
of brushless DC motor applications. The device includes an on-chip Hall voltage generator
for magnetic sensing, a comparator that amplifies the Hall voltage, and a Schmitt trigger to
provide switching hysteresis for noise rejection, and complementary open-collector drivers
for sinking large current loads. An internal bandgap regulator is used to provide
temperature compensated supply voltage for internal circuits and allows a wide operating
supply range.
If a magnetic flux density larger than threshold Bop, DO is turned on(low) and DOB is
turned off (high). The output state is held until a magnetic flux density reversal falls below
Brp causing DO to be turned off and DOB turned on.
A277 are rated for operation over temperature range from -20 oC to 85 oC and voltage
range from 3.5V to 20V. The devices are available in low cost die forms or rugged 4 pin
SIP packages.
